2026 Panini FIFA World Cup Sticker Box: Features and Contents
The 2026 Panini FIFA World Cup Sticker Box is part of Panini's official tournament collection and comes in multiple configurations.
| Product Version | MSRP |
| 25-Pack Box | $50.00 |
| 50-Pack Collection Box | $99.99 |
| Starter Bundle with Album + 5 Packs | $15.00 |
Current pricing is based on listings from Amazon US and Panini America at the time of writing.
What You Can Expect Inside
The larger 50-pack version includes:
- 50 sticker packs
- 7 stickers per pack
- Approximately 350 stickers per box
- Official FIFA World Cup player stickers
- Team crests and national badges
- Stadium and host city stickers
- Tournament-themed graphics
- Special foil stickers
- Amazon-exclusive parallel variations in select products
Panini lists the 50-pack box configuration as containing 50 packs with 7 stickers per pack.

The Size of the 2026 Collection
The 2026 tournament introduces the largest FIFA World Cup field in history with 48 participating nations.
As a result, Panini's sticker collection has expanded significantly:
- 980 total stickers
- 68 special stickers
- 112-page official album
This makes it one of the biggest Panini World Cup releases ever produced.
For collectors, that means more players, more national teams, and more trading opportunities throughout the tournament season.

Long-Term Collectibility
Many buyers view the Panini sticker collection as more than a short-term hobby.
Historically, World Cup memorabilia tends to maintain interest long after the tournament ends. The combination of official licensing, limited production periods, and global demand helps support collector interest over time.
That said, not every sticker becomes valuable. Most collectors purchase these products for enjoyment, nostalgia, and album completion rather than investment purposes.
If long-term value matters to you, focus on:
- Sealed boxes
- Rare foil inserts
- Special parallel variations
- Complete albums in excellent condition
Is the 2026 Panini FIFA World Cup Sticker Box Worth the Price?
Value depends largely on your collecting goals.
For casual collectors:
- The 25-pack box offers a lower-cost entry point.
- The Starter Bundle works well if you need an album.
For serious collectors:
- The 50-pack box delivers better volume.
- More packs mean more opportunities to pull special stickers.
- Larger purchases reduce the need for frequent reorders.
At around $99.99 for the 50-pack version, pricing aligns closely with Panini's official retail pricing.
Keep in mind that completing the entire FIFA sticker album still requires trading and additional purchases due to duplicates. Some industry estimates suggest completing all 980 stickers through pack purchases alone can become quite costly.
